Brief Summary

The aim of this study is to empirically evaluate the impact of a Dance/Movement Therapy program adapted to older adults. Participants over 60 years old are enrolled in one of three groups: Dance/Movement Therapy, Aerobic Exercise or Waiting List (control group) for 12 weeks. The training groups occur 3 times a week for 1 hour each session. Physical condition, cognitive function, general health and lifestyle, and stress hormones are assessed at baseline, after 12 weeks and after 28 weeks.

Inclusion Criteria
  • aged 60 years and older
  • sedentary or moderately sedentary (less than 150 minutes of moderate to vigorous exercise per week)
  • have not participated in another similar study in the last year
  • have not been exposed to a dance or dance/movement therapy program in the past year
  • are not in a wheelchair
  • have not had surgery in the past year
  • have not smoked in the past 5 years
  • do not consume more than 2 glasses a day of alcohol
  • are not in treatment for major depression
Exclusion Criteria
  • progressive neurological disorder
  • unstable medical conditions (unstable cardio illness in the past 6 months, cardiac or thyroid troubles or pituitary gland illness)
  • contraindication for moderate physical activity (major orthopaedic limitations)
  • suspicion of cognitive problems (score of 24 or less on the Mini-Mental State Examination)
  • large uncorrected perceptual limits
  • treatment of hormone therapy
  • uncontrolled hearing loss
